Close, but not that close!

Lately the idea of shaving like men before me did has consumed my life. After reading an article by Corey Greenburg, the Today Show consumer reporter, about a new trend of men using double edge safety razors to shave http://www.msnbc.msn.com/id/6886845/. Corey promotes the use of a double edge (DE) safety razor as well as some other "old school" products. Well, being the trendy man I am, I had to get on board. I ordered, a heavy steal DE safety razor, a new shave brush, new shave cream, and plenty of replacement blades. As my anticipation grew, while the package was being shipped, I thought about a close, fresh shave. One like my granddad had in a barber shop.

The package came yesterday afternoon, and as soon as I got home I took the new diggs for a spin. Lathered up and ready to cut those pesky hairs, I went to work. Carefully gliding the blade along my face with the short, light strokes as instructed in about a billion web blogs dedicated to the subject.

I cleaned up a few nicks and felt like I had the closest shave ever. But let me be the first to tell you, it was REALLY close. So close, I got a nice case of razor burn!

Oh well, I suppose that's the learning curve, I'll give it a shot again tonight.
